I have the Canon adapter LADC58D on my G6. Bought a $4.00 Quantaray snap on kind at Ritz and it falls off real easy. What do you use?
TIA

I purchased a canon lens cap and it works perfectly. I had the one you talk about from ritz and it was garbage, the buttons always stuck, horrible craftsmanship on thos caps. I purchased 2 canon lens caps off eBay (I think, hard to remember) they were like $8.00 each and $2 to ship both. They are black and have the canon name in silver on the front... looks great and works perfect.
